> Doesn't *every* home router purchased in the last 5 years support one  
> of UPnP or NAT-PMP? That's been my experience, at least.

Not all of them.

More to the point, I'm not aware of any corporate routers that support these
things. It's too much of a security risk to be able to have arbitary machines
on your LAN set up port forwards.
